JAMSHEDPUR – A controversy arose in Sidhgora after a proposed police sub-inspector allegedly hurled an abusive remark at a retail shopkeeper.
The incident came to light when the shopkeeper shared a video of the abuse with BJP’s former leader Vikas Singh. Singh later forwarded the clip to Jamshedpur SSP Piyush Pandey.
However, while sending the video, Singh criticized the officer in a satirical tone. He suggested that the sub-inspector should be honored with a medal on January 26 for insulting a hardworking shopkeeper.
Moreover, Singh accused the district police of ignoring widespread illegal trade. He alleged that daily lottery and narcotic substances were being openly sold in every neighborhood with police support.
A source familiar with the matter remarked, “The situation reflects poorly on law enforcement credibility in the city.”
